Serif Normal Nygow 7 is a regular weight, normal width, high contrast, upright, normal x-height font visually similar to 'Delvona' by Great Studio (names referenced only for comparison).

A high-contrast serif with bracketed, wedge-like terminals and a smooth, oldstyle rhythm. Strokes show clear modulation with comparatively thin hairlines and stronger verticals, while serifs taper into pointed or flared ends rather than square slabs. The lowercase is compact and steady with rounded bowls and moderate apertures; the italic influence is minimal, but the shaping carries a subtle calligraphic feel in curves and joins. Numerals follow the same contrast and serif treatment, reading clearly with traditional proportions.

Well-suited to long-form reading in books, journals, and editorial layouts where contrast and classic serif detailing support a polished typographic color. It also performs nicely for headlines, pull quotes, and refined brand applications that want a conventional, trustworthy voice.

The overall tone is traditional and literary, projecting authority without feeling rigid. Its crisp contrast and tapered serifs add refinement, suggesting editorial seriousness and a slightly historic, book-centered character.

The design appears intended as a dependable, traditional text serif that balances readability with a refined, high-contrast finish. Its tapered serifs and measured proportions suggest an aim toward classic page typography with enough personality for display use when set large.

Capitals are stately and slightly wide, with generous interior space in letters like O and C. Some joins and terminals (notably in letters like a, e, s, and y) show gentle, pen-like flicks that add texture in larger sizes while remaining controlled in paragraph settings.
